Google Analytics is a service by Google that provides a platform for businesses and website owners to track and report activity on their websites. The platform measures various data points about a website, such as how many people visit and what cities or countries those visitors are from. Analytics also provides in-depth information about customer journeys, from specific pages users visit when entering your website to all pages they visit during their time on your site.
Google Analytics helps businesses understand how their websites perform, how people use them, and what aspects of a website need improving to retain or convert more users. Many companies use Google Analytics, with most using the Universal Analytics version. On October 14, 2020, Google introduced a new version, Google Analytics 4 (GA4). GA4 is the new version of Google’s unified analytics platform. GA4 helps marketers and business owners collect data, understand customer journeys, and put their data in understandable, readable reports for all their websites and apps. As with previous versions of Google Analytics, Google Analytics 4 benefits businesses by helping them understand their websites’ performance and how customers use their sites. However, this new version will affect how companies access their earlier data and how they translate the future data.
Universal Analytics will stop processing new hits on July 1, 2023, and only process GA4 data. That means Universal Analytics will not track the activity of people visiting your website from July 2, 2023, and afterward. After that, only GA4 will process user activity on websites and apps.
After that date, you can still access previous data for a time. However, you will not be able to use Universal Analytics for future tracking and marketing analysis. In addition, Google will eventually prevent businesses from accessing Universal Analytics entirely. So if you have Universal Analytics but not GA4, you will have to upgrade to collect and maintain your customer data.

Because Google will stop tracking on July 2, 2023, and eventually drop Universal Analytics entirely, having an archive of that data is vital to being able to see your website performance comparisons.
GA4 also has features that allow business owners to obtain more in-depth information about their customers.
As mentioned above, if you do not upgrade to Google Analytics 4 and only have Universal Analytics, you will lose access to all historical Google Analytics data. Losing access to this data impacts your ability to compare how your website performed vs. previous periods.
